I am writing to announce a reallocation of functions between groups to meet business needs, as well as the appointment of two executives.

TTC Organization Chart, effective August 6, 2017

An expanded People Group will absorb the work previously undertaken by the Human Resources Department, reflecting the enlarged mandate of HR over the last several years, a mandate that now includes Diversity and Human Rights.

The newly named People Group is headed by Chief People Officer, Gemma Piemontese. As Gemma’s deputy, I am pleased to announce that Megan MacRae becomes Executive Director – Human Resources and will join the Executive Team.

While Gemma oversees the areas of Training and Development, Diversity and Human Rights, Investigative Services, Policy Development and the HR Service Centre (including Payroll), Megan will oversee Benefits, Compensation, Occupational Health and Claims Management, Employment Services, Employee Relations and Employee Development.

I am also pleased to announce that Tara Bal, who headed up Internal Audit, has been named Acting Chief Financial Officer of a revised Corporate Services Group that includes Finance, IT, Materials and Procurement and Pensions. Christine Leach will be Acting Head of Internal Audit.

These changes are effective August 6.
